My impression on most shriveled roots is that they are often air roots that have formed in a greenhouse humid environment and then since have shriveled for lack of moisture in a significantly different place. If you have the same problem with roots in the media you may have to wait for new roots to form at the base of the plant - which should happen if you have enough humidity now. A root stimulant (like Superthrive) may help revive any roots that are questionable as to whether they are going to survive or not. What kind of media do you have your plant in?
